如何在Word中將所有尾註轉換為純文本
將尾註轉換為文本將方便您編輯或刪除尾註。 例如,如果您想一次選擇帶有其他常規文本的尾註,Word將不允許您這樣做。 您如何輕鬆完成它? 本教程將向您展示幾種將尾註轉換為純文本的方法。
手動將尾註轉換為文本
1.將光標放在尾註所在的位置,然後按 按Ctrl + A 從文檔中選擇所有尾註。 看截圖:
2。 按 按Ctrl + C 複製尾註。
3。 按 CTRL + END 將光標移動到整個文檔的末尾和尾註之前。
4。 按 按Ctrl + V 將尾註粘貼到文檔末尾。 尾註的順序將保持不變,但粘貼的尾註已更改。 看截圖:
5.手動將文本前面的所有數字1替換為原始數字列表。
使用VBA將尾註轉換為文本
換句話說,您還可以使用VBA代碼將尾註轉換為純文本。
1:按 Alt + F11 打開一個 Microsoft Visual Basic for Applications窗口;
2:點擊 模塊 插入 標籤,將以下VBA代碼複製並粘貼到 模塊 窗口;
3:點擊 跑 按鈕或按下 F5 應用VBA。
將尾註轉換為文本的VBA:
子convertendnote()
昏暗的aendnote作為尾註
對於ActiveDocument.Endnotes中的每個aendnote
vbCr和aendnote.Index _的ActiveDocument.Range.InsertAfter
&vbTab和aendnote.Range
aendnote.Reference.InsertBefore“ a”和aendnote.Index&“ a”
下一個aendnote
對於ActiveDocument.Endnotes中的每個aendnote
附註.參考.刪除
下一個aendnote
Selection.Find.ClearFormatting
Selection.Find.Replacement.ClearFormatting
帶有Selection.Find.Replacement.Font
。上標=真
結束
隨著Selection.Find
.Text =“(a)([0-9] {1,})(a)”
.Replacement.Text =“ \ 2” v .Forward = True
.Wrap = wdFindContinue
.Format =真
.MatchWildcards = 真
結束
Selection.Find.Execute替換:= wdReplaceAll
END SUB
注意: 您可以更改宏的開頭和結尾以適應您的喜好。
使用Kutools for Word將尾註轉換為文本
對於那些剛接觸計算機的新手來說,VBA太複雜而無法處理。 但是隨著 Kutools for Word 安裝後,您可以快速將所有尾註轉換為文本 Convert Endnotes to Text 一鍵實用程序。
Kutools for Word, 與以上 方便的功能,使您的工作更加輕鬆。 | ||
安裝後 Kutools for Word,請執行以下操作:(現在免費下載Kutools for Word!)
1.請點擊以下方式應用此實用程序 庫工具 > 轉 > Convert Endnotes to Text。 看截圖:
2。 點擊後 Convert Endnotes to Text,您將看到如下屏幕截圖所示的結果:
演示:將所有尾註轉換為單詞文本
相關文章:
分頁瀏覽和編輯多個Word文檔/ Excel工作簿,如Firefox,Chrome,Internet Explore 10! |
您可能很熟悉在Firefox / Chrome / IE中查看多個網頁,並通過輕鬆單擊相應的選項卡在它們之間進行切換。 在這裡,Office選項卡支持類似的處理,使您可以在一個Word窗口或Excel窗口中瀏覽多個Word文檔或Excel工作簿,並通過單擊它們的選項卡輕鬆地在它們之間進行切換。 |